Punjab includes Shubman Gill, Abhishek Sharma and Arshdeep in their 2025 Vijay Hazare squad.

Shubman Gill

Get the latest updates on the Vijay Hazare Trophy 2025 as Punjab announces its star-studded squad, featuring Shubman Gill, Abhishek Sharma, and Arshdeep Singh. Catch all the key matchups and player highlights in this National One-Day Championship.

Shubman Gill, after being dropped from India’s T20 World Cup squad, will return to domestic action. However, his availability might be limited to just two or three games, as India’s ODI series against New Zealand is set to begin on January 11. Similarly, Arshdeep Singh, a key white-ball regular, is expected to feature in the opening matches but may have to leave soon to join the national team. These dynamics make their appearances in the early games crucial for Punjab.

Punjab, which has been placed in Group C alongside heavyweights like Mumbai, will face off against Maharashtra on December 24 and Chhattisgarh on December 26. Both Gill and Arshdeep are expected to play in these initial fixtures, making them key matchups for the team. These early games will not only provide Punjab a chance to test their top players but also help gauge how the squad is shaping up for the later stages of the competition.

Key Fixtures and Early Challenges

Punjab’s fixtures in the group stages of the 2025 Vijay Hazare Trophy are expected to be tough, with the team facing some of the most competitive sides in the tournament. After their opening matches against Maharashtra and Chhattisgarh, Punjab’s next major test will come on January 8, when they take on Mumbai in a marquee clash in Jaipur.

Unfortunately, both Shubman Gill and Rohit Sharma of Mumbai will miss this high-profile match due to their national duties. This leaves a gap for both teams, but the match will still be a major event as both sides are among the strongest in the tournament. With Mumbai’s star-studded lineup and Punjab’s mix of international and domestic players, the game is expected to be a thrilling encounter. However, Punjab will need to rely on their depth, especially in the absence of key players, and younger talents such as Prabhsimran Singh and Harnoor Pannu will have to step up to fill the void left by Gill and Arshdeep’s absence.
